Measurements of Fusion Reactions of Low-Intensity Radioactive Carbon Beams on C12 and their Implications for the Understanding of X-Ray Bursts
P. F. F. Carnelli,Sergio Almaraz-Calderon,K. E. Rehm,M. Albers,Martín Alcorta,P. F. Bertone,B. DiGiovine,Henning Esbensen,J. O. Fernández Niello,D. J. Henderson,C. L. Jiang,J. Lai,S. T. Marley,O. Nusair,T. Palchan-Hazan,R. C. Pardo,M. Paul,Claudio Ugalde +17 more
TL;DR: A good agreement between the experimental and theoretical cross sections is observed, which gives confidence in the ability to calculate fusion cross sections for systems which are outside the range of today's radioactive beam facilities.
Multi-Sampling Ionization Chamber (MUSIC) for measurements of fusion reactions with radioactive beams
P. F. F. Carnelli,Sergio Almaraz-Calderon,K. E. Rehm,M. Albers,Martín Alcorta,P. F. Bertone,B. DiGiovine,Henning Esbensen,J. O. Fernández Niello,D. J. Henderson,C. L. Jiang,J. Lai,S. T. Marley,O. Nusair,T. Palchan-Hazan,R. C. Pardo,Michael Paul,Claudio Ugalde +17 more
TL;DR: In this article, a detection technique for high-efficiency measurements of fusion reactions with low-intensity radioactive beams was developed, based on a Multi-Sampling Ionization Chamber (MUSIC) operating as an active target and detection system, where the ionization gas acts as both target and counting gas.
Be 9 + Sn 120 scattering at near-barrier energies within a four-body model
A. Arazi,J. Casal,J. Casal,M. Rodríguez-Gallardo,J. M. Arias,R. Lichtenthäler Filho,D. Abriola,O. A. Capurro,María Angélica Cardona,P. F. F. Carnelli,E. de Barbará,J. O. Fernández Niello,Juan Manuel Figueira,L. Fimiani,Daniel Hojman,G. V. Martí,D. Martínez Heimman,A. J. Pacheco +17 more
TL;DR: In this paper, the elastic angular distribution of the weakly bound nucleus of a three-body projectile is analyzed with a four-body continuum-discretized coupled-channels (CDCC) calculation.
